The Beebe Chamber of Commerce has awarded its highest honor, the Dr. Ruth Couch Lifetime Service Award, to longtime community leader Cathy Eoff.

The recognition was presented during the Chamber’s Annual Banquet on April 2, celebrating a lifetime of service, leadership, and lasting impact in Beebe Arkansas.

A resident of Beebe since 1975, Eoff has built a legacy as a respected business leader and philanthropist. She has served as President and Broker of Eoff & Associates Realty since 1994, and also owns Eoff Farms, continuing her family’s agricultural tradition.

In 2006, Eoff established the Ben T. & Edith M. Eoff Family Endowment, which continues to provide scholarships that benefit students at Arkansas State University-Beebe.

Her commitment to education spans more than 30 years, including leadership roles on the university’s Development Council and Board of Visitors.

Beyond education, Eoff has played a key role in local leadership through service on the Centennial Bank Board, the Beebe Chamber of Commerce, and various economic development initiatives, as well as the Beebe Junior Civic League.

Eoff has also dedicated more than 20 years mentoring youth at First Baptist Church Beebe, along with supporting numerous charitable efforts, including animal rescue.

Community leaders say her lifelong dedication, generosity, and servant leadership have left a lasting mark on Beebe Arkansas.

The Dr. Ruth Couch Lifetime Service Award recognizes individuals whose work has shaped the community for generations—an honor that reflects Eoff’s enduring impact.
